--- Begin Message ---Package: partman-crypto Hi, I installed rom today's i386 netinst (20061016) with the following setup: /dev/hda1 16MB /boot /dev/hda2 500MB physical volume for encryption /dev/hdb1 516MB physical volume for encryption Both crypto partitions were setup for dm-crypt. On the top of these two partitions LVM was created with one big logical partition for /. Everything went fine up to the reboot to the new system. I was asked for the first passphrase, after which the boot process failed to setup the lvm device (of course, the second partition was still locked) and I was dropped to the initramfs shell: Begin: Mounting root file system... ... Begin: Running /scripts/local-top ... Volume group "vg" not found Enter LUKS passphrase: key slod 0 unlocked. Command succesfull. Couldn't find device with uuid 'DZ9wMr-ECxI-boX4-wmr8-v07z-Ni2E-bb30fy'. Couldn't find all physical volumes for volume group vg. Couldn't find device with uuid 'DZ9wMr-ECxI-boX4-wmr8-v07z-Ni2E-bb30fy'. Couldn't find all physical volumes for volume group vg. Volume group "vg" not found /scripts/local-top/cryptroot: failed to setup lvm device Done. Begin: Waiting for root file system... ... Done. Check root= bootarg cat /proc/cmdline or missing modules, device: cat /proc/modules ls /dev ALERT! /dev/mapper/vg-ROOT does not exist. Dropping to a shell! Content of /conf/conf.d/cryptroot: CRYPTOPTS="target=hdb1_crypt,source=/dev/hdb1,lvm=vg-ROOT" -- Miroslav Kure
